New Fire Service club teaches Staffordshire kids how to stay safe

By Jack Lenton

9th Jun 2021 | Local News

A new club run by Staffordshire Fire and Rescue Service is teaching little ones across the county how to keep themselves safe.

The Welephant Club is an online safety resource that aims to help parents discuss important safety topics with their kids.

The club is free and is suitable for children aged between four and eight years old.

Topics covered include:

- Fire safety

- Water safety

- Road safety

- Outdoor safety
